    Margie Klein, interpretive naturalist with the Red Rock Canyon Visitor’s Center, gives an overview of Red Rock Canyon National Conservation Area to U.S. Army Corps of Engineers geologists before the group heads out to participate in a paleoflood exercise and hike the Keystone Thrust Fault trail March 15 at the conservation area near Las Vegas.
